Financial Analyst
Position Type: Full Time
Location: US (Remote) or Mexico City, Mexico
Ecoplexus Inc. ( www.ecoplexus.com ) is a rapidly growing renewable energy developer. Ecoplexus continues to grow at a rapid rate, and expects to complete approximately $2 Billion of projects over the next four years. The Company has developed and completed over 80 projects in the U.S. and internationally, and has a 1 GW pipeline in Mexico.
We are seeking a talented self-starter, who is highly motivated and capable of assuming increasing responsibility in a dynamic growth environment.
Job Overview
Based in the United States or Mexico City, this role is a contributor to Ecoplexus' U.S. based project finance and development teams. In this role you will be responsible for financial analysis related to project acquisitions and development, modeling debt and tax equity financial structures, and assisting with closing activities for project M&A, debt and tax equity financings. Assignments will include modeling project economics & scenario testing, organizing & managing project due diligence, and obtaining information from other internal groups to support contract negotiation and closing processes.
There is opportunity for additional responsibilities and professional growth for candidates who learn quickly and apply themselves. You will learn about the development, financing, construction, and management of solar power projects from the ground up. In this role you will have international exposure, working for the US based team and LATAM.
The ideal candidate will have the following:
• Solid understanding of project finance concepts
• Strong quantitative aptitude with advanced Excel and modeling skills, VBA and SQL skills a plus.
• Ability to communicate effectively both verbally and in writing
• Detail-oriented with a strong sense of personal responsibility and ownership of work product
• Highly resourceful, organized and comfortable working in an unstructured, entrepreneurial environment; this is a transaction-based environment where requirements and deadlines are dictated by deal flow and an ability to manage competing priorities is essential
• Capability to read and interpret legal contracts
Job Duties and Responsibilities:
• Review and develop an in-depth understanding of different transaction structures and develop and review complex financial models for these structures
• Develop finance and development marketing materials, as well as support relationships with existing partners
• Organize and present information for partners performing due diligence on Ecoplexus projects
• Assist in the review and negotiation of project finance contractual agreements, as well as track deliverables under such agreements
• Facilitate the internal flow of information between finance, development, legal and engineering teams during transaction execution
• Manage project appraisal and cost segregation processes
• Analyze project economics and internally communicate financial model results
• Work with C-level executives
• Supporting other corporate objectives as needed
Required Qualifications
• Undergraduate degree required; quantitative disciplines are desired
• Minimum 1-3 years of relevant experience; work experience in renewable energy, real estate development, investment banking or other transactional finance a significant plus
• Near-native fluency in English required
Ecoplexus offers a competitive salary, bonus structure, potential for employee stock options in a growing company, benefits program, and flexible working conditions.
